My ipod froze ...what can I do to start or stop it?

My ipod classic (360GB) just froze up while I was playing vortex game on it..I think the battery was low but I thought I could just plug it in and it would be ok. I can't get it off or on or anything..There is only a blank white screen on it and I can't even turn it off. Could you please help if you know what might cause this or how I can fix it? Thank you.

    Toggle the Hold switch on and off. (Slide it to Hold, then turn it off again.)

    Press and hold the Menu and Center (Select) buttons simultaneously until the Apple logo appears, about 6 to 8 seconds. You may need to repeat this step.

    Hold down the Center and Menu button for 5 seconds to reset your iPod. You will lose no data. If this fais, connect your iPod to iTunes and restore it. This WILL delete everything. Good luck and I hope you don't lose anything!
